I applied on their website, and it was a few weeks before I was contacted by a recruiter. During that phone call, basic questions about why I was interested was ask, and what shows I would be interested in interning on. They also asked what prior experience I had in the field of production, as well as why I think I'd be a good fit for NBC. After that, I received a second phone call. During this call certain job positions that were available were revealed to me, and I was asked which I would prefer. Then another phone call was initiated by a person from the specific department in which my choice was in. Was asked basic questions, and it seemed very promising. However I shortly received an email from the 3rd caller stating they decided to move forward with somebody else.
